Abstract
Purpose
This paper considers an e-tailer planning to distribute a product under one direct sales channel and multiple asymmetric agency platforms. Based on the multinomial logit (MNL) choice model, this study optimizes the pricing strategy and channel selection strategy to maximize the e-tailer’s profit.
Design/methodology/approach
A two-stage channel selection and pricing problem is formulated, where the profit-maximizing e-tailer first optimally selects a specified number of agency platforms from a set of alternatives to distribute the product and then determines the optimal prices in those channels.
Findings
An optimal pricing strategy is proposed to maximize the e-tailer’s total profit on multiple asymmetric channels. The results show that the e-tailer can obtain a higher profit by selling products on more asymmetric agency platforms. Moreover, an effective channel selection algorithm is provided to help the e-tailer optimally select the M agency platforms from N alternatives.
Originality/value
This study enriches the relevant research on multichannel selection and pricing by proposing an optimal pricing strategy and an effective channel selection algorithm. Evaluation results based on real-world industrial data show that the proposed optimal multichannel pricing strategy in this paper can significantly improve the profit of a real-world e-tailer compared to the e-tailer’s actual profit.

Abstract
Purpose
The purpose of this study is to contribute to empirical research on individual ambidexterity drivers. This paper analyzes the relationships between inclusive leadership, team knowledge acquisition, team knowledge sharing, digital tools usage and individual ambidexterity.
Design/methodology/approach
This study conducted a questionnaire survey of high-tech and manufacturing enterprises in China and obtained 75 leader questionnaires and 365 employee questionnaires. The hypotheses were tested using hierarchical and cross-level regressions.
Findings
The research indicates that inclusive leadership improves team knowledge acquisition and sharing. However, only team knowledge sharing significantly boosts individual ambidexterity, and not team knowledge acquisition. Thus, inclusive leadership fosters individual ambidexterity primarily through team knowledge sharing. Digital tools usage strengthens the impact of inclusive leadership on team knowledge sharing, thereby intensifying its effect on individual ambidexterity. However, digital tools usage weakens the effect of inclusive leadership on team knowledge acquisition.
Originality/value
First, this study addresses the call for research on ambidexterity at different levels, revealing the heterogeneous impact of team knowledge acquisition and sharing on individual ambidexterity. Second, this study developed a theoretical model to explore how leadership affects individual ambidexterity. Third, this study responds to the question that digitalization has won, but has leadership lost by investigating the role of digital tools usage in the relationship between inclusive leadership and team knowledge integration.

Abstract
Purpose
This study explores the factors influencing artificial intelligence (AI)-driven decision-making proficiency (AIDP) among management students, focusing on foundational AI knowledge, data literacy, problem-solving, ethical considerations and collaboration skills. The research examines how these competencies enhance self-efficacy and engagement, with curriculum design, industry exposure and faculty support as moderating factors. This study aims to provide actionable insights for educational strategies that prepare students for AI-driven business environments.
Design/methodology/approach
The research adopts a hybrid methodology, integrating partial least squares structural equation modeling (PLS-SEM) with artificial neural networks (ANNs), using quantitative data collected from 526 management students across five Indian universities. The PLS-SEM model validates linear relationships, while ANN captures nonlinear complexities, complemented by sensitivity analyses for deeper insights.
Findings
The results highlight the pivotal roles of foundational AI knowledge, data literacy and problem-solving in fostering self-efficacy. Behavioral, cognitive, emotional and social engagement significantly influence AIDP. Moderation analysis underscores the importance of curriculum design and faculty support in enhancing the efficacy of these constructs. ANN sensitivity analysis identifies problem-solving and social engagement as the most critical predictors of self-efficacy and AIDP, respectively.
Research limitations/implications
The study is limited to Indian central universities and may require contextual adaptation for global applications. Future research could explore longitudinal impacts of AIDP development in diverse educational and cultural settings.
Practical implications
The findings provide actionable insights for curriculum designers, policymakers and educators to integrate AI competencies into management education. Emphasis on experiential learning, ethical frameworks and interdisciplinary collaboration is critical for preparing students for AI-centric business landscapes.
Social implications
By equipping future leaders with AI proficiency, this study contributes to societal readiness for technological disruptions, promoting sustainable and ethical decision-making in diverse business contexts.
Originality/value
To the author’s best knowledge, this study uniquely integrates PLS-SEM and ANN to analyze the interplay of competencies and engagement in shaping AIDP. It advances theoretical models by linking foundational learning theories with practical AI education strategies, offering a comprehensive framework for developing AI competencies in management students.

Abstract
Purpose
This study aimed to investigate the impact of benevolent leadership on proactive customer service performance by creating a moderated mediation model. The model focuses on the role of harmonious passion as a mediator in the relationship between benevolent leadership and proactive customer service performance as well as the moderating influence of proactive personality on this mediation.
Design/methodology/approach
The model was tested using data from 339 immediate supervisor-subordinate pairs in eight five-star hotels in Egypt. Frontline service employees and their immediate supervisors completed separate questionnaires, and the responses were matched using identification numbers.
Findings
The results indicate that harmonious passion fully mediates the positive relationship between benevolent leadership and proactive customer service performance. Additionally, proactive personality was found to moderate the mediated relationship between benevolent leadership and proactive customer service performance through harmonious passion, such that the mediation was stronger for employees with higher proactive personalities.
Research limitations/implications
By testing the moderated mediation model, this study contributes to our theoretical understanding of the motivational mechanism through which benevolent leadership influences proactive customer service performance.
Originality/value
This research offers initial evidence of the mediating role of harmonious passion in the positive relationship between benevolent leadership and proactive customer service performance. The moderated mediation model extends existing findings by incorporating proactive personality as a significant moderator in explaining the impact of benevolent leadership on proactive customer service performance.

Abstract
Purpose
Managers in China prioritize the cultivation of loyal employees, resulting in positive effects associated with leader-member exchange (LMX). However, fragmented evidence suggests that LMX also can trigger deviant behavior. LMX provides employees with access to resources, while it also harbors potential risks for deviant behaviors. Based on the cognitive-affective system theory of personality and resource-related theories, this study aims to explore the double-edged sword effects of LMX by examining how LMX influences interpersonal deviant behaviors through emotional and cognitive pathways, respectively.
Design/methodology/approach
This study involved three waves of paired data surveys that were conducted in China over one month, and a total of 117 leaders and 235 subordinates participated in this study.
Findings
Even though LMX as a job resource reduces workplace anxiety, LMX also generates work overload for employees. Workplace anxiety and work overload further result in interpersonal deviant behavior. Narcissistic admiration, as a personality trait, can weaken the mediating role of work overload but not that of workplace anxiety.
Practical implications
The finding can help managers pay attention to negative effect of LMX and provide suggestions for preventing employees’ workplace deviant behavior.
Originality/value
The findings revealed how LMX leads to negative outcomes in the workplace. In addition, the results demonstrated the buffering effect of narcissistic admiration on the negative effect of LMX.

Abstract
Purpose
This study examines the effectiveness of enterprise resource planning (ERP) system implementation in Russian companies, considering the vendor’s country of origin and the context of sanctions.
Design/methodology/approach
To estimate the impact of implementation, the event study method is employed, with a control group selected using propensity scores matching to address the issue of systematic self-selection. Operational efficiencies are calculated using the Stochastic Frontier Estimation method. The impact of the vendor’s country and the sanctions context is evaluated using regression analysis. The dataset comprises large manufacturing companies in Russia that adopted ERP systems between 2007 and 2021.
Findings
The results show that Russian companies benefit in operational efficiency even during the preparation phase for ERP implementation, and this effect persists up to a year post-implementation, after which it diminishes. Additionally, companies implementing ERP systems of foreign vendors gain more from the implementation. Moreover, the sanctions context drives an increase in operational efficiency. Furthermore, initially less efficient firms receive greater benefits from the implementation of ERP systems, while efficient firms receive smaller gains in operational efficiency.
Originality/value
This study offers new insights into how the choice of domestic or foreign vendor influences the impact of ERP adoption on operational efficiency in emerging economies. Our methodological contribution lies in extending the framework for analyzing operational efficiency to include firms with negative operating income, which is important in the context of emerging markets and turbulent environments.

Abstract
Purpose
Green manufacturing (GM) has emerged as a vital strategy to minimize environmental impacts and maximize resource efficiency in industrial production. The main aim of this work is to identify and validate essential criteria for GM and prioritize drivers of successful GM implementation frameworks for the manufacturing industry based on Best–Worst Methodology (BWM).
Design/methodology/approach
This work explores the essential factors required to achieve long-term success in GM, followed by their comparison using the BWM to determine the most and least important indicators. The study conducted purposive sampling to gather data from 15 experts representing diverse industries in the manufacturing sector. The research methodology consists of three main steps: criteria identification through literature review, criteria validation using the content validity ratio (CVR) method and the BWM application to rank the indicators.
Findings
The main success factors identified included top management commitment, organizational culture, employee training, cost saving, investment in innovation and technology, environmental regulation, zero-emission and waste management. The results obtained through BWM indicated top management commitment, investment in innovation and technology and organizational culture as the most critical factors for successful GM implementation. Other factors, such as zero-emission, waste management and cost savings, were also significant but ranked lower in significance. In conclusion, this study highlights the importance of top management commitment to successfully adopting GM initiatives.
Originality/value
This research provides insights into the key success factors, through which decision-makers are assisted in prioritizing efforts and implementing sustainable and eco-friendly practices in manufacturing processes. However, further research is recommended to address existing gaps and foster a deeper understanding of crucial success factors for successful GM implementation.

Abstract
Purpose
Prefabricated building projects (PBPs) require multiple stakeholder collaboration due to the strong linkages between the design, production and installment of the precast components. Current contractual governance fails to foster a trusting environment for stakeholder collaboration, leading to conflicts of interest, cost overrun and delays in project schedules. Previous studies revealed that terminating shortcomings in contractual governance can be mitigated by implementing relational governance mechanisms. This study aims to explore the configurational effects of contractual and relational governance mechanisms on stakeholder collaboration in PBPs and identifies the practical configurational conditions to achieve high stakeholder collaboration.
Design/methodology/approach
Data were collected from 39 experts through semi-structured interviews and analyzed to explore the configuration effects on stakeholder collaboration in PBPs through fuzzy-set qualitative comparative analysis (fsQCA).
Findings
Our study reveals that stakeholder collaboration requires configurational conditions of multiple governance elements (i.e. historical working experience and risk-sharing, reward, selection, authorization, trust, commitment and communication mechanisms). Four equivalent configurational strategies were identified for achieving high stakeholder collaboration in PBPs. These included three configurational strategies dominated by relational governance mechanisms and one configurational strategy complementary to contractual and relational governance mechanisms. The configurations dominated by relational governance mechanisms were developed with communication mechanisms and historical working experiences as core conditions; the configurational strategy with complementary contractual and relational governance mechanisms was centered on risk-sharing, reward and trust mechanisms as core conditions.
Originality/value
Our study enriches the literature on the antecedents of stakeholder collaboration in the PBPs by testing the significance of the relational governance mechanism, which expands the implications of relational contract theory. It also expands the implications of stakeholder theory in PBPs by exploring the asymmetric causal relationship between project contractual governance and stakeholder collaboration. Meanwhile, this study recommends countermeasures for managers to improve stakeholder collaboration by providing four practical configurational conditions in PBPs.

Abstract
Purpose
This study aims to provide a practical and novel solution for the complex multi-criteria decision-making (MCDM) problem of airline route selection, which is characterized by conflicting criteria, alternative routes, and complex judgments.
Design/methodology/approach
This study proposes a hybrid MCDM approach using Interval-valued Pythagorean Fuzzy AHP and Interval-valued Pythagorean Fuzzy weighted aggregated sum product assessment (WASPAS) methods. Decision analysis is applied to select a new route between different alternatives through selection criteria. Pythagorean Fuzzy AHP is used for weighting criteria, and Pythagorean Fuzzy WASPAS is used for assessing alternatives. The pair-wise linguistic comparisons of selection criteria are transferred into Pythagorean fuzzy numbers (PFNs) to weigh each criterion’s importance.
Findings
The pair-wise linguistic comparisons of selection criteria are transferred into PFNs to weigh each criterion’s importance. The results of these comparisons show that the main criteria, cost (43% weight) and demand (33% weight), impact route selection decisions more than social/economic conditions (15% weight) and competitiveness (9% weight). Regarding the criteria, the five routes alternative were evaluated by the route development experts, and the best route was selected with Pythagorean Fuzzy WASPAS.
Practical implications
The proposed model is used for a route selection problem of Turkish Airlines, the airline that flies to the most countries in the world.
Originality/value
To the best of the authors’ knowledge, this study is the first to use the Interval-valued Pythagorean Fuzzy AHP combined with Interval-valued Pythagorean Fuzzy WASPAS to solve the route selection problem. This hybrid MCDM methodology presents a novel and feasible solution for selecting the new route for airlines.

Abstract
Purpose
This study investigates the nonlinear relationship between inventory leanness and ESG (environmental, social and governance) performance, exploring how market concentration and digital transformation moderate this connection in manufacturing enterprises.
Design/methodology/approach
Using a large panel data collected from Chinese listed manufacturing enterprises over the period from 2012 to 2021, this research employs the instrumental variable method combined with two-stage least squares estimators to explore the U-shaped relationship between inventory leanness and ESG performance. Furthermore, the moderating roles of market concentration and digital transformation are demonstrated.
Findings
The results reveal an inverted U-shaped relationship between inventory leanness and ESG performance, indicating that moderate lean inventory management enhances ESG outcomes, but excessive reduction hinders them. Additionally, market concentration and digital transformation positively moderate this relationship, suggesting that competitive market conditions and technological advancement mitigate the adverse effects of overly lean inventories.
Practical implications
Managers are advised to balance inventory management with market dynamics and embrace digital transformation to optimize ESG performance. Policymakers can leverage these insights to guide firms in sustainable inventory practices.
Originality/value
This study contributes to the literature by unveiling the nonlinear dynamics between inventory leanness and ESG performance and highlighting the moderating roles of market concentration and digital transformation.
